Transaction ffd5412169f6d4ea198342731cfd359614ed11307d956727b1a96203f275b228
1 Input
1 Output
-
ffd5412169f6d4ea198342731cfd359614ed11307d956727b1a96203f275b228:0
- value
- 632544
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d2ea46487d18cf13ee92f8330315ba29fbcf124
- address
- bc1qh5h2gey86xx0z0hf97pnqv2m520meufyspeyxj